XNOR gate in PDSO16 — what the package and function mean for the board
The 74AC11810D is a single XNOR gate in the AC logic family, built on a CMOS process and housed in a PDSO16 package. The 16-pin small-outline footprint is the same 1.27 mm pitch as the industry-standard SOIC-16, so the layout matches any existing SOIC-16 pad pattern without a board spin. As an XNOR gate, it outputs a logic-high when both inputs match — the equality-check function used in data comparators, address decoding, and parity validation. The AC family's 2-V to 6-V supply range and typical 8-ns propagation delay keep it compatible with 3.3-V and 5-V logic interfaces running at moderate clock rates.
Active lifecycle and the RoHS non-compliance flag
The RoHS compliance status is marked as non-compliant. This means the device contains lead (Pb) above the 0.1 % threshold — typical for the older AC-logic series where the die-attach or lead-finish used tin-lead solder. For builds that require RoHS exemption 7(c)-I (lead in electronic ceramic parts) or that fall under military/aerospace contracts with a leaded-solder allowance, this part is a direct fit. For RoHS-mandated consumer or automotive production, the buyer must verify the exemption applies or source a lead-free alternative.
